How Dystr works
Users begin their journey with Dystr by signing up and accessing a personalized dashboard that displays their projects. From there, they can create isolated workspaces for collaboration and run code or AI Workers. As teams work together in real-time, they can save and fork analyses, ensuring ongoing synchronization of datasets and calculations while boosting productivity.

Enterprise-Grade Security
Dystr ensures top-tier data protection with its enterprise-grade security measures, including AES-256 encryption for data at rest and TLS 1.2+ for data in transit. This commitment to security guarantees that customer data remains confidential and exclusive to the users, enhancing trust and reliability in project management.
